Tennessee hosts multiple military surplus auctions through federal and state platforms, largely due to the presence of military installations and National Guard facilities across the state. These auctions feature equipment and materials from the Department of Defense, Army Corps of Engineers, and other federal agencies that regularly dispose of surplus inventory. Bidders in Tennessee can access these listings through GSA Auctions, GovDeals, GovPlanet, and PublicSurplus, with new items added throughout the year.
Tennessee government auctions include vehicles, communications equipment, tools, machinery, office furniture, and various tactical gear. Items come from military bases, federal warehouses, and defense contractors in the region. The specific inventory changes regularly, so checking auction sites frequently helps you find items matching your needs.
You'll need to register an account on the auction platform where the item is listed, such as GSA Auctions, GovDeals, or GovPlanet. Each site has its own registration and bidding process. Read the item description and condition details carefully, understand shipping and pickup options, and place your bid before the auction closes. Most platforms require payment within a set timeframe after winning.
Some items may have export restrictions or require special licensing to purchase, depending on their classification and intended use. Certain equipment might be restricted to government agencies or nonprofit organizations. Always review the auction listing's terms and contact the selling agency if you're unsure whether you're eligible to bid on a specific item.
